On 23 December 2020, online presentations regarding a transport simulation case study took place between Thai and Japanese researchers. To report the assignment set at the last seminar session in November, the researchers had developed case studies on transport simulation. In total 17 participants were gathered from Kasetsart University, the Asian Institute of Technology (AIT), Chiang Mai University, Kagawa University and Chubu University. Their case studies were highly praised by Prof. Masanobu Kii of Kagawa University, and Dr. Varameth Vichiensan of Kasetsart University. The presentations were on very timely topics, including, for example, before-and-after COVID-19 pandemic simulation by the Chiang Mai team, and a simulation of the evacuation from the Tsunami disaster in Phuket by AIT team. A doctoral student at Chubu University, Mr. Witsarut Achariyaviriya, constructed a simulation focused on enhancing Quality of Life (QOL) in Bangkok, which could promote a new work-life balanced lifestyle as well as solving traffic congestion issues.
